Brief Summary
|
Introduction: A neonate, or newborn infant under 28 days old, undergoes critical developmental changes and is highly vulnerable to health risks, including adverse drug events. Infants in the NICU are exposed to a large number of medications that increase the risk of causing potential drug-drug interactions and thereby lead to adverse drug events.
Objectives: • To assess the potential drug-drug interactions among neonates admitted to NICU department. • To assess the risk category of potential drug-drug interactions among neonates.
Methodology: A retrospective study will be conducted in NICU of Justice K.S. Hegde Hospital for 8 months, with a sample size of 240 neonates (2020–2024) using convenience sampling. Data will be collected on demographics, drugs prescribed, and potential DDIs analyzed and categorized using UpToDate and Medscape.
Inclusion criteria: • Neonates (<28 days of age) who have been admitted in NICU department at K.S. Hegde hospital. • Neonates prescribed with at least 2 medications. • All neonates, both preterm and term will be included • Neonate with clear and complete patient data will be included.
Exclusion criteria: • Neonates born in any hospital other than Justice K.S. Hegde charitable Hospital will be excluded.
Statistical analysis: The data will be entered in MS excel and analysed using SPSS [V29.0]. The continuous data will be expressed as mean +SD and categorical values will be presented in frequency [%]. Data will also be represented as graphs or diagrams
outcome: Common DDIs among neonates can be identified and categorized based on severity. Length of hospital stay can be corelated with the number of DDIs. |
